Decoding the CBS Broadcast Windows
CBS typically reserves its most prominent windows for Saturday afternoons and Thursday night showcases, creating a reliable rhythm for college basketball enthusiasts. During the regular season, the network often focuses on marquee conferences, ensuring that blue-blood programs and rising contenders appear on national television. Viewers should consult their local CBS affiliate specifically, as regional variations exist for SEC, Big Ten, and ACC games that might air on different networks in different markets.
Time Zone Considerations and Game Windows
The start times listed on the CBS NCAA basketball television schedule often reflect Eastern Time, which can create confusion for fans in other zones. A game scheduled for 7:00 PM ET might appear as 4:00 PM PT on the West Coast, impacting dinner plans and viewing habits. Cable subscribers should verify their channel lineup to ensure they are tuned to the correct regional feed broadcasting the specific conference game.
Navigating the Conference Tournament Surge
As the regular season concludes, the CBS NCAA basketball television schedule intensifies, with the network securing key slots during the major conference tournaments. Weeks like ACC, Big Ten, and SEC championship weekends result in multiple games per day, often featuring bubble teams and rivalry matchups. This concentrated dose of basketball provides a clear pathway to March Madness, setting the stage for the selection show and the opening rounds.
March Madness and the Selection Show
The NCAA Tournament announcement show is a major event in its own right, and CBS delivers extensive coverage leading into the field cut. The network’s analysts break down the brackets, discuss the latest bids, and preview the first weekend matchups. This programming acts as the bridge between the regular season and the single-elimination chaos, offering context for every team on the board.
Leveraging Streaming for Flexibility Modern viewing habits have expanded access to the CBS NCAA basketball television schedule through streaming platforms that carry the network. Services like Paramount+ with SHOWTIME often include the channel, allowing cord-cutters to watch games on smart TVs, tablets, and phones. This flexibility ensures that fans can follow their team regardless of location, provided they have a stable internet connection and a compatible device.
